![]() In this new format, the argument has been settled. Last Pro Tour we had a legitimate debate as to whether Atarka Red or Mono-Red was the better choice. If you consider only the three “pillars” of the event ( GW Megamorph, Jeskai Black, and Atarka Red), which made up between 40 and 55 percent of the field, there is little doubt Atarka Red was the worst of the lot. So while the deck was a fine choice for the tournament, it wasn't a great choice nor can it be considered a "breakout" deck. Slightly is the key word here - in conversation rate, 21+ finishes, and 18+ finishes, Atarka Red pilots showed up at about three percent more often than the field at large. Overall, the deck put up a reasonable, but unsuperlative performance, coming in slightly above average on all metrics, with the exception of high-end finishes (24 points or more) where it was below average.
